Windows 10 не использует всю оперативную память

Почему на Windows 10 доступна не вся оперативная память? Как исправить данную неполадку

Устраняем проблему с неиспользуемой RAM

Причин у описываемой проблемы существует немало. В первую очередь источником является программный сбой в определении ОЗУ. Также ошибка появляется и вследствие аппаратной неисправности как модуля или модулей, так и материнской платы. Начнём с программных неполадок.

Способ 1: Настройка Windows

Первая причина проблем с использованием «оперативки» – некорректные настройки операционной системы, как правило, параметров работы с этими комплектующими.

  1. На «Рабочем столе» нажмите сочетание клавиш Win+R. В окне «Выполнить» введите команду msconfig и кликните «ОК».

Открыть утилиту настройки ОС для решения проблемы с неиспользуемой ОЗУ в Windows 10

Откройте вкладку «Загрузка», найдите кнопку «Дополнительные параметры» и щёлкните по ней.

Дополнительные параметры загрузки для решения проблемы с неиспользуемой ОЗУ в Windows 10

В следующем окне найдите опцию «Максимум памяти» и снимите с неё отметку, после чего нажмите «ОК».

Отключить максимум памяти для решения проблемы с неиспользуемой ОЗУ в Windows 10

Нажмите «Применить» и «ОК», и затем перезагрузите компьютер.

Применить изменения загрузки для решения проблемы с неиспользуемой ОЗУ в Windows 10

Способ 2: «Командная строка»

Также стоит попробовать отключить несколько опций, доступных через «Командную строку».

  1. Откройте «Поиск», в котором начните вводить слово командная. После обнаружения результата выделите его, затем обратитесь к меню справа и воспользуйтесь пунктом «Запуск от имени администратора».

Открыть командную строку для решения проблемы с неиспользуемой ОЗУ в Windows 10

После появления интерфейса ввода команд пропишите следующее:

bcdedit /set nolowmem on

Ввод первой команды для решения проблемы с неиспользуемой ОЗУ в Windows 10

Нажмите Enter, затем пропишите следующую команду и снова воспользуйтесь клавишей ввода.

bcdedit /set PAE forceenable

Вторая команда для решения проблемы с неиспользуемой ОЗУ в Windows 10

После изменения параметров закрывайте «Командную строку» и перезагружайте компьютер.

Данный метод является более продвинутой версией первого.

Способ 3: Настройка BIOS

Не исключены также неправильные настройки микропрограммы «материнки». Параметры следует проверить и изменить.

  1. Войдите в БИОС любым подходящим методом.

    Войти в БИОС для решения проблемы с неиспользуемой ОЗУ в Windows 10

    Урок: Как войти в BIOS

  2. Интерфейсы BIOS отличаются у разных производителей материнских плат, соответственно, отличаются и нужные нам опции. Находятся они обычно в разделах «Advanced» или «Chipset». Примерные названия приводим далее:
    • «Memory Remapping»;
    • «DRAM Over 4G Remapping»;
    • «H/W DRAM Over 4GB Remapping»;
    • «H/W Memory Hole Remapping»;
    • «Hardware Memory Hole»;
    • «Memory Hole Remapping»;
    • «Memory Remap Feature».

    Параметры нужно включить – как правило, достаточно переместить соответствующую опцию в положение «On» или «Enabled».

Включить переназначение памяти для решения проблемы с неиспользуемой ОЗУ в Windows 10

Нажмите F10 для сохранения изменений и загрузите компьютер.

Если вы не можете найти подходящие пункты, не исключено, что производитель заблокировал такую возможность на вашей модели «материнки». В этом случае поможет либо прошивка новой версии микропрограммы, либо замена системной платы.

Читайте также: Как обновить BIOS

Способ 4: Уменьшение памяти, используемой встроенной видеокартой

Пользователи ПК или ноутбуков без дискретной видеокарты часто сталкиваются с рассматриваемой проблемой, поскольку встроенные в процессор решения пользуются «оперативкой». Часть из неё закреплена за интегрированной графикой, причём объём задействованной ОЗУ можно изменить. Делается это следующим образом:

  1. Войдите в БИОС (шаг 1 предыдущего способа) и переключитесь на вкладку «Advanced» или же любую, где фигурирует этот термин. Далее найдите пункты, которые отвечают за работу графической подсистемы. Они могут называться «UMA Buffer Size», «Internal GPU Buffer», «iGPU Shared Memory» и в таком роде. Обычно шаги объёма фиксированы и опустить его ниже определённого порога не получится, поэтому выставьте минимально возможное значение.

Задать значение памяти для решения проблемы с неиспользуемой ОЗУ в Windows 10

В оболочке UEFI ищите разделы «Дополнительно», «System Configuration» а также просто «Memory».

Открыть опции Shared Memory для решения проблемы с неиспользуемой ОЗУ в Windows 10

Далее откройте разделы «Конфигурация системного агента», «Расширенные настройки памяти», «Integrated Graphics Configuration» либо подобное, и задайте требуемый объём по аналогии с текстовым БИОС.

Установить значение Shared Memory для решения проблемы с неиспользуемой ОЗУ в Windows 10

Нажмите клавишу F10 для выхода и сохранения параметров.

Сохранить изменения Shared Memory для решения проблемы с неиспользуемой ОЗУ в Windows 10

Способ 5: Проверка модулей ОЗУ

Нередко источником ошибки являются неполадки с планками оперативной памяти. Проверить их и устранить возможные проблемы можно по следующему алгоритму:

  1. Первым делом проверьте работоспособность «оперативки» одним из программных способов.

    Проверка памяти для решения проблемы с неиспользуемой ОЗУ в Windows 10

    Урок: Проверка оперативной памяти в Windows 10

    Если появятся ошибки, сбойный модуль нужно заменить.

  2. При исправности всех используемых элементов выключите компьютер, откройте его корпус и попробуйте поменять планки местами: часто встречаются случаи аппаратной несовместимости.
  3. Если сами планки разные, причина может быть именно в этом – специалисты не зря советуют приобретать китовые наборы из одинаковых комплектующих.
  4. Нельзя исключать и неисправности системной платы, поэтому советуем использовать заведомо рабочие элементы ОЗУ. В случае поломки главной схемы компьютера её тоже проще всего будет заменить.

Аппаратные неисправности – одна из самых редких причин описываемой проблемы, однако и самая неприятная из возможных.

Заключение

Таким образом, мы рассказали, почему в Виндовс 10 появляется сообщение о том, что используется не вся оперативная память, а также предложили варианты устранения этой ошибки.

ЗакрытьМы рады, что смогли помочь Вам в решении проблемы.
ЗакрытьОпишите, что у вас не получилось.

Наши специалисты постараются ответить максимально быстро.

Помогла ли вам эта статья?

ДА НЕТ

Поделиться статьей в социальных сетях:

Еще статьи по данной теме:

Почему не доступна вся оперативная память

Основная причина, почему системой используется не вся оперативная память на Windows 10, заключается в неверно выставленных настройках БИОСа. Компьютер автоматически скрывает объем, который затем не отображается в операционной системе (ОС).

Иногда проблема может быть связана с аппаратными неполадками, когда разъемы и материнская плата функционируют некорректно.

Важно! На 32-разрядной Windows 10 будет полностью определяться только 3.25 ГБ ОЗУ, даже если фактически установлено больше. Это связано с ограничениями указанной разрядности. Если этого объема мало, потребуется установить 64-битную версию ОС.

Узнать разрядность системы можно в свойствах компьютера:

  1. Чтобы открыть соответствующее меню, необходимо в окно «Выполнить», которое запускается посредством нажатия Win + R, ввести команду msinfo32 и нажать клавишу Enter.

Ввод msinfo32 в «Выполнить»

  1. Напротив пункта «Тип» будет находиться текущая разрядность. Обозначение x86 указывает на использование 32-битной версии, а x64 — 64-битной.

Тип

Проблемы с разъемом или ОЗУ

Зачастую причина «невидимости» ОЗУ лежит буквально на поверхности — банальная невнимательность при установке модулей. В зависимости от материнской платы память может фиксироваться в разъеме двумя способами: двухсторонней защелкой или защелкой с одной стороны. Вне зависимости от способа, фиксация происходит со звонким щелчком, который характеризует плотную посадку в разъем. 

Не стоит сбрасывать со счетов и брак в изделиях. Разъем может быть заведомо нерабочим, как и планка памяти. Выявление дефектной планки потребует несколько простых шагов. Для начала стоит почистить контакты ластиком и продуть от пыли разъем, а также сбросить разгон модулей и поменять их местами. Следующий шаг — тестирование по отдельности каждого модуля в заведомо рабочем разъеме. Для этих целей можно воспользоваться популярной программой TestMem5, которая проверяет память на наличие ошибок. Процесс этот не быстрый, особенно в случае наличия двух и более модулей, но действенный.

Довольно редкий, но заслуживающий упоминания случай — несовместимость конкретной платы и модуля памяти, при том, что по отдельности они полностью рабочие. Казалось бы, выход прост — покупка памяти из рекомендуемого QVL листа платы, но и тут есть нюанс. Производитель включает в список лишь ту память, которую успел протестировать, так как модулей на рынке огромное количество и протестировать их все с каждой конкретной платой практически невозможно. 

QVL лист на примере платы Gigabyte B550M Gaming

Поэтому, если ваших модулей нет в списке, но они подходят по основным критериям, то препятствий к установке нет. И, конечно, не стоит забывать о правильной последовательности использования разъемов. Она индивидуальна для каждой конкретной платы и указана в мануале устройства.

Описание

Система определяет меньший объем оперативной памяти, чем установлено в компьютере.

Или системе доступна не вся память:

Windows доступна не вся оперативная память

Также в БИОС может определяться не весь ее объем (чаще, только половина).

Лимит объема памяти поддерживаемой процессором и платой 

Материнская плата и процессор имеют вполне конкретные ограничения по объему устанавливаемой оперативной памяти. В связи с этим, для рабочих задач, где требуется большой объем ОЗУ, стоит более тщательно подходить к выбору основных комплектующих.

Максимально поддерживаемый объем памяти на примере Intel i5 10400F

Что же касаемо массового бытового сегмента, то современные бюджетные решения поддерживают минимум 32 Гб ОЗУ, не говоря про более продвинутые модели, что хватит с запасом для домашнего/игрового ПК.

Максимально поддерживаемый объем памяти на примере ASRock Z590 Pro4

Как же узнать лимит конкретного устройства? Достаточно просто. Нужно зайти на сайт производителя процессора/платы и найти спецификацию конкретной модели.

Ограничения 32-битных систем

Конечно, если на компьютере установлена операционная система с архитектурой 32 бита, все проблемы можно было списать исключительно на ее разрядность, ведь такие модификации Windows с объемами памяти выше 4 Гб работать просто «не приучены» изначально. Поэтому единственно правильным решением для исправления ситуации станет самая обычная замена системы х86 (32 бита) на 64-разрядную.

ОЗУ 8 Гб в 32-битной Windows 7

Но ведь иногда можно встретить и случаи, когда в той же Windows 7 х86 память 8 Гб видна, а доступным оказывается размер до 4 Гб. А вот это как раз и связано с ограничениями, которые подразумевает 32-битная архитектура. Впрочем, ситуация может быть еще банальнее, поскольку и материнская плата не всегда дает разрешение на использование полного объема ОЗУ. Чтобы не менять «железо», можно обратиться к некоторым скрытым программным инструментам, которые помогут решить такую проблему если не в полной мере, то хотя бы частично.

Как исправить ситуацию

Решить задачу можно несколькими способами: от изменения настроек системы и подсистемы, до замены комплектующих — в крайнем случае.

Инструкция: Как настроить оперативную память в БИОСе: инструкция в 4 простых разделах

Настройка конфигурации

В операционке, например, Windows 10 Home All Languages, может быть установлен лимит объема, поэтому она и не видит всю оперативу. Как его снять:

  • В поиске Windows набрать «Конфигурация системы».
  • В открывшемся окне перейти во вкладку «Загрузка».
  • Кликнуть по разделу «Дополнительные параметры».
  • Проверить, что отметка на «Максимум памяти» не установлена.

настройка конфигурации

Обновление BIOS

Еще один способ решить проблему. Как действовать,подскажет таблица.

Обновление БИОС в режиме DOS

Обновление BIOS в режиме Windows
Уточнить производителя платы, модель и точную версию установленного БИОСа. Для обновления нужно скачать файл с новой версией микропрограммы и саму программу прошивки под Windows. У каждого производителя — собственная утилита.
Скачать файл прошивки для обновления версии с официального сайта. Установка идентична большинству софта: через стандартный ехе файл. 
Взять чистый носитель информации. отформатировать его и создать загрузочный диск. По запросу типа файла нужно указать «обновление из файла».
На сайте производителя обычно можно скачать и сам прошивочный софт, например, awdflash.exe.  Выбрать предварительно загруженный файл Биос. 
В файле autoexec.bat нужно прописать софт для прошивки и путь к файлу. Интересно: ПО некоторых производителей, например, ASUS, может обновляться из интернета. 
Софт скачает последнюю версию BIOSа и все обновится автоматически.
Например: awdflash.exe newvbios.bin /py.  
При необходимости можно указать имя файла для сохранения текущей версии БИОС, как страховку на случай, если что-то пойдет не так.  
Теперь можно вставить носитель и приступить к обновлению.  
Важно! Пока Bios обновляется, нельзя выключать или перезагружать компьютер.

обновление БИОС в DOS и Виндовс

Сброс настроек BIOS

Так как подсистема отвечает за сбор сведений о ПК, уже при запуске операционки могут возникнуть трудности, и понадобится сброс настроек. Сделать это можно так: 

  1. Обесточить компьютер и надеть электростатические перчатки, браслет.
  2. Разобрать ПК,чтобы получить доступ к системной плате.
  3. Вытащить батарейку из материнки минут на 15.
  4. Засунуть ее обратно.
  5. Закрыть корпус.
  6. Подключить PC к источнику питания и запустить.

сброс Bios — достать батарейку

Смена планок ОЗУ местами

Банальная перестановка модулей памяти иногда тоже работает. Сначала нужно повторить первые два шага из предыдущего раздела. Потом — вытащить планки и поменять их местами. Если есть свободные слоты, можно попробовать задействовать их.

Читайте также: Как увеличить оперативную память (RAM) ноутбука в 5 шагов: способы и советы

Как задействовать всю оперативную память в Windows любой версии?

Итак, первым делом необходимо запустить конфигуратор системы, вызываемый командой msconfig, но обязательно с правами администратора. Если в консоли «Выполнить» такой пункт отсутствует, сначала необходимо активировать «Диспетчер задач», а затем, используя файловое меню, задать выполнение новой задачи, вписать указанную команду и отметить пункт создания задачи с правами администратора. Как задействовать всю оперативную память, вне зависимости от архитектуры?

Снятие ограничений по использованию ОЗУ

Для этого в конфигураторе следует перейти на вкладку загрузки, нажать кнопку дополнительных параметров, а в появившемся окне настроек снять флажок с пункта использования максимума памяти, в поле которого наверняка будет указано значение ниже полного объема ОЗУ. Этот пункт целесообразно активировать только в том случае, если производится включение всех ядер процессора, когда для каждого ядра и указывается максимальный размер памяти.

Устранение ограничений с помощью командной строки

Некоторые настройки использования памяти можно изменить только через командную строку. Чтобы это сделать, нужно нажать «Пуск» и в строке поиска начать вводить данное словосочетание. Когда приложение найдется, в меню справа выбрать «Запуск от имени администратора».

Наглядное руководство, как зайти в командную строку на виндовс 10.

Обратите внимание! Можно перейти в консоль, нажав «Win + R» и введя в окне «cmd».

Далее делают следующее:

  1. В консоли пишут «bcdedit /set nolowmem on» (без кавычек).
  2. Нажав «Enter», вводят следующую команду — «bcdedit /set PAE forceenable».

После этого также нажимают «Ввод», закрывают окно командной строки и перезагружают устройство.

Резервирование памяти 

Самой распространенной ситуацией является резервирование ОЗУ под нужды встроенного в процессор видеоядра, так как без памяти работать оно не сможет. Если при установке процессора никаких настроек не производилось, то система автоматически выделяет необходимый объем памяти. Чтобы проверить размер выделенной памяти, достаточно зайти в диспетчер задач комбинацией клавиш «Ctrl+Shift+Esc». В графе «Графический процессор» найти пункт «Выделенная память». В примере ниже в систему установлена одна планка памяти объемом 8 Гб, из которой 2 Гб отданы на нужды видеоядра.

Пример системы с процессором AMD, встроенным видеоядром и отсутствием дискретной видеокарты

Чтобы изменить размер выделяемой памяти, потребуется зайти в BIOS платы. Название нужного пункта в BIOS может различаться, но в большинстве случаев это «Share Memory» или «Graphic Mode». Подробную информацию можно найти в мануале платы. Можно задать желаемый объем выделяемой памяти или вовсе отключить видеоядро, естественно, при наличии дискретной видеокарты. Возможны ситуации, когда часть оперативной памяти направляется для нужд дискретной видеокарты. Данный нюанс наблюдается при больших нагрузках на видеокарту, когда собственной памяти устройства не хватает. Еще один вариант, свойственный некоторым ноутбукам — при наличии и видеоядра, и дискретной видеокарты задействуется ОЗУ. Происходит это при минимальных нагрузках, когда дискретная видеокарта не нужна и задействуется видеоядро, попутно забирая часть ОЗУ под свои нужды. 

В чем была проблема?

Если вам удалось решить проблему, поделитесь своим опытом для других:

Программное ограничение

«Преграды» на размер объема ОЗУ могут быть выставлены внутри ОС. Проверить это можно, перейдя на вкладку системы следующим путем: «Поиск->msconfig->Конфигурация системы->Загрузка->Дополнительные параметры». 

Атрибут «Максимум памяти» должен быть не активен, в ином случае нужно просто снять с него галочку.

Понравилась статья? Поделиться с друзьями:
Добавить комментарий

;-) :| :x :twisted: :smile: :shock: :sad: :roll: :razz: :oops: :o :mrgreen: :lol: :idea: :grin: :evil: :cry: :cool: :arrow: :???: :?: :!: